Mengenalkan Gempabumi Kepada Generasi Usia Dini
( Jalan rusak akibat gempabumi. Sumber: https://xdesignmw.wordpress.com/2009/10/12/bangunan-tahan-gempa )
Sebagai salah satu negara yang memiliki aktivitas kegempaan cukup tinggi, Indonesia wajib memiliki mitigasi bencana gempabumi yang sudah memadai mulai dari ketahanan bangunan yang kokoh akan goncangan gempabumi, langkah evakuasi ketika gempabumi terjadi yang efektif , serta edukasi perihal gempabumi dan pelatihan penanggulangan bencana gempabumi kepada masyarakat luas.
Hingga saat ini, belum ada satupun teknologi dan metode modern di dunia yang dapat memprediksi gempabumi secara akurat. Salah satu kalangan masyarakat yang berisiko terkena ancaman gempabumi adalah para siswa-siswi sekolah. Gempabumi dapat saja terjadi pada saat kegiatan belajar-mengajar berlangsung di sekolah. Bertolak dari latar belakang tersebut, sudah semestinya pemberian edukasi mengenai gempabumi kepada para siswa sangatlah penting. Bukan hanya itu, melakukan simulasi pelatihan menghadapi bencana gempabumi secara rutin di sekolah-sekolah juga tak kalah pentingnya.
Selama ini, langkah dari BMKG untuk memberikan edukasi dan sosialisasi perihal gempabumi selain dari media cetak dan elektronik adalah melalui workshop yang biasa disebut dengan Table Top Exercise atau Gladi Ruang Mitigasi Bencana Gempabumi yang hanya dilakukan di daerah tertentu yang rawan akan gempabumi dan pesertanya hanya beberapa pihak yang berada di sekitarnya seperti sekolah-sekolah, Polisi, TNI, Pemda, Dinas Kesehatan, BPBD, dan Masyarakat umum. Adapun kegiatan lain adalah berupa kunjungan sekolah-sekolah ke kantor BMKG untuk belajar mengenai gempabumi yang dilakukan atas inisiatif dari pihak sekolah tertentu. Solusi lain yang dirasa perlu untuk dilakukan adalah dengan menambahkan mata pelajaran mengenai bencana gempabumi beserta mitigasinya ke dalam kurikulum sekolah. Selain itu, simulasi bencana gempabumi juga perlu dilakukan secara rutin di sekolah. Hal ini tentu saja tidak bertujuan untuk memberatkan para siswa, gagasan diatas justru sangat bermanfaat untuk membentuk karakter generasi muda yang siap menghadapi bencana gempabumi.
Metode serupa bahkan telah diterapkan oleh negara Jepang sejak gempabumi besar menghantam daerah Kobe pada tahun 1995. Kala itu gempabumi Kobe menelan korban lebih dari 65.000 jiwa. Negara sakura itu akhirnya dapat menurunkan jumlah korban bencana gempabumi yang terjadi setelah setelah gempabumi Kobe sejak dimasukkannya mata pelajaran dan pelatihan mengenai gempabumi pada kurikulum sekolah.
( Latihan dan simulasi menghadapi gempabumi di sekolah dasar dan taman kanak-kanak di Jepang. Sumber: http://www.isigood.com/wawasan/peringatan-20-tahun-gempa-kobe-6-434-lilin-dinyalakan-jepang-berdoa-dan-belajar )
Kita berharap bahwa dengan memasukkan edukasi dan pelatihan rutin evakuasi bencana gempabumi ke dalam kurikulum di sekolah dapat mengurangi dampak kerugian bencana gempabumi sejak dini. Semua ini bukan bertujuan untuk memberatkan para siswa, Hal ini justru dimaksudkan untuk menyadarkan pada generasi muda bahwa gempabumi tidak dapat dihindari dan kita harus siap menghadapinya kapan saja. Thanks a lot Mr.Asep for your dedication in preserving the Sundanese culture and colouring my childhood 😊 ( Al-Fatihah ) . . . *Bonus* This is the official credit from Google https://www.google.com/doodles/asep-sunandars-61st-birthday Today we celebrate what would be the 61st birthday of Asep Sunandar, one of the world’s most famous wayang golek masters. Wayang golek is a style of puppet theater that hails from Sunda, in the western part of the Indonesian island of Java. It’s an art form that takes years to master, and is an important piece of Sunda’s culture. Wayang golek puppets are made of wood, and are controlled by rods that are connected to their hands and head. The wayang golek master is responsible for the entire show - he or she decides which story they will tell, most often an Indian epic story, and manages all of the wooden puppets’ movements and voices. Well over 10 characters can appear in each show! Sunandar delighted audiences for years with his performances, which could last from dusk ‘til dawn.
